About Paducah

Paducah is located in the state of Kentucky, in the United States. It is situated in the western part of the state, where the Ohio and Tennessee rivers meet. This strategic location has played a significant role in the city's development and history.

Paducah has a rich cultural heritage and a strong sense of community. The city is known for its historic downtown area, artistic vibe, and outdoor recreational opportunities. Its economy is driven by a mix of industries, including healthcare, education, and manufacturing. Paducah's unique character and natural beauty make it a notable destination in the region.
